Frequently asked questions about Powhatan Elementary

How many students attend Powhatan Elementary?

Powhatan Elementary has 656 students enrolled. It is a public school in Clayton, NC. CCD year-over-year: 616 (2022-23) → 614 (2023-24), nearly flat (-2).

What is the student-teacher ratio at Powhatan Elementary?

The student-teacher ratio at Powhatan Elementary is 15.6:1, which is 1% lower than the North Carolina average of 15.8:1 and 1% lower than the national average of 15.7:1. Lower ratios generally mean more individual attention per student.

What percentage of students receive free lunch at Powhatan Elementary?

29.5% of students at Powhatan Elementary are eligible for free lunch, compared to the North Carolina average of 66.0%.

What is the racial and ethnic makeup of Powhatan Elementary?

The largest demographic group at Powhatan Elementary is White at 52.6% of enrollment, in Clayton, NC. Its student body is more racially and ethnically mixed than most US schools, with a diversity index of 64.4/100.

What is the Resource Investment Index for Powhatan Elementary?

Powhatan Elementary has a Resource Investment Index of 43/100 (typical reported resources relative to schools nationally) based on 4 factors: student-teacher ratio, gifted-program reporting, counselor availability, chronic absenteeism.
